Medical Genetics and Genomics

The Division of Medical Genetics and Genomics at The Mount Sinai Hospital specializes in the screening, diagnosis, and treatment of adult and pediatric patients with or suspected of having genetic diseases, birth defects, reproductive complications, or cancer risks. Our team includes doctors who specialize in medical genetics, as well as genetic counselors, nutritionists, nurse practitioners, and social workers. Our Department of Genetics and Genomic Sciences is one of the largest in the country dedicated to the understanding, prevention, treatment, and cure of genetic diseases and birth defects.

Rare Disease Center of Excellence

The Division of Medical Genetics and Genomics is proud to serve patients as a National Organization of Rare Diseases Center of Excellence. With this designation, Mount Sinai joins a highly selective nationwide network of 31 medical centers that specialize in rare disorders. This innovative network fosters knowledge-sharing between experts across the country, connects patients to appropriate specialists regardless of disease or geography, and improves the pace of progress in rare disease diagnosis, treatment, and research. Centers were chosen based on their ability to provide exceptional rare disease care and have demonstrated a deep commitment to serving rare disease patients and their families using a holistic, state-of-the-art approach.
